Vol 6 – Chapter 24: Got you. Taeil.

Jeong Taeui didn’t know if what he was doing was right. Until he reached the first floor, Jeong Taeui didn’t stop even once, silently looking down at his feet in the elevator. Maybe he was regretting it. Could this prickling worry in his heart be called regret?

“…….Do I really want to do this?”

As soon as the words left his mouth, he felt a heavy weight.

This wasn’t simply about caring for or looking after someone. It wasn’t a one-sided thing, it had to come from both sides. A person would need a lot of energy to care for someone continuously. And he didn’t know how much energy he would need to always be there for someone like that.

Basically, each person is an individual, with completely different thoughts and behaviors. Even those who seem similar at first glance will have different thoughts and decisions. And even deciding to stay with a normal person would require a lot of consideration and effort to get along. Jeong Taeui didn’t even know who was the right person for him and who wasn’t.

For a normal person, one would have to be well-prepared to face this, let alone……. well, he didn’t even know if the person he wanted to be with for life could be considered human.

“Why am I losing my spirit like this…….”

Jeong Taeui muttered sadly.

Ilay Riegrow. That man was truly a madman. Anyone who had ever met him would come to that conclusion.

Maybe it would be better if he followed Xinlu’s advice. Maybe he should live a stable life away from that madman.

But.

Jeong Taeui knew.

Even if Xinlu held him back and let him choose again. He would still choose the same.

He would choose to stay with Ilay Riegrow.

The elevator reached the first floor. Jeong Taeui stepped into the lobby; it was still early morning.

In the end, Jeong Taeui had silently sat by Xinlu’s side all night, and Xinlu hadn’t opened his eyes again until he left. Occasionally, he would think about something else, look at Xinlu, think about this and that, and then look at Xinlu again.

And then he left the room without closing his eyes. The thought of going back to him kept swirling in his mind.

It was still early, and there were very few people in the lobby. As soon as he saw others, Jeong Taeui remembered his thoughts from the previous night. There was one issue he had forgotten.

“Yeah……. I definitely need to buy a hat first…….”

Jeong Taeui reached into his pocket and took out the card he had taken from Xinlu’s wallet.

After all, it was Xinlu who brought him here, so it wasn’t unreasonable for him to take some responsibility. Besides, he planned to return the card later.

In the large hotel lobby, Jeong Taeui suddenly froze.

Come to think of it, there were more than one or two problems at hand. The most important thing was that now he couldn’t do anything. Even though he had a card full of money in his pocket (although it wasn’t his) – aside from that, he had nothing else. Without a passport, he couldn’t leave. Or even if he had a passport, he couldn’t rush to the airport because now he was a globally wanted terrorist. Therefore, he needed to be very careful about how he revealed himself at this moment.

“This is the first time I’ve been in such a hopeless situation…….”

Jeong Taeui scratched his head. In this situation, what he could do was…….

Suddenly, Jeong Taeui’s eyes landed on a public phone booth in the corner of the lobby, and he quickly walked towards it, but then stopped again. All he had in his pocket was the card. Going to a bank to withdraw money and exchange it for coins might cause even more trouble. If he had known this, he would have taken out some cash…….

Jeong Taeui regretted it too late and looked around worriedly. There was a 24-hour convenience store near the lobby. Since it was still too early, there was only one employee sitting there, with all sorts of advertisements pasted on the glass door.

Jeong Taeui nodded to himself and walked over.

He opened the glass door and stepped in. The employee who had been yawning continuously sat up straight and smiled friendly.

Jeong Taeui handed over the card and picked up the phone. A moment of silence passed, he glanced at the numbers displayed on the phone screen and dialed the numbers he remembered in his head.

Calculating the time difference, it was probably almost lunchtime over there.

The long beeping signals, there was no sign of anyone picking up on the other end, but just as Jeong Taeui started to worry, the phone stopped ringing, replaced by a familiar voice.

[“Hello, this is Jeong Changin…….”]

“Uncle, it’s Taeui.”

Jeong Taeui interrupted before his uncle could finish speaking. There was silence on the other end for a moment, and then laughter rang through the phone.

[“Oh, isn’t this the second nephew of ours who’s proudly wanted for terrorism?”]

Jeong Taeui clicked his tongue bitterly. That label would haunt him for the rest of his life. No, it was still better than being caught.

“Uncle……. please help me.”

Jeong Taeui mumbled dejectedly. Normally, he would happily respond to his uncle’s jokes, but now he had no energy left. His uncle laughed for a while before replying with a slightly tired voice.

[“If it’s something I can help with, I’d be happy to. What do you need? A fake passport? Or a cop willing to take a bribe so you don’t get caught at the airport?”]

Jeong Taeui smiled. His uncle’s words sounded like a joke, but they weren’t. His uncle always knew exactly what he needed.

“Both.”

[“Alright. When do you need it?”]

“Right now. I plan to go to the airport immediately. Is that possible?”

His uncle was silent for a moment after hearing this, seemingly contemplating something, but then he quickly responded in a light-hearted manner.

[“A bribable cop is easy, but the passport might be a bit difficult if you need it immediately. However, if you’re only using it once, it’s simple enough.”]

“Yes, that’s fine.”

[“Good. I’ll arrange it and send the passport to the airport right away. I’ll give you a contact number when you get to the airport, so call me when you arrive.”]

“Yes, thank you, uncle.”

[“You’re welcome……. But if it’s this, Xinlu could have done it too.”]

Jeong Taeui hesitated in silence. After all, it wasn’t something he couldn’t tell his uncle, plus he had something he needed to ask.

“I’m not with Xinlu anymore. I have somewhere I want to go, so I can’t go with Xinlu.”

For a moment, no words came from the phone. However, unexpectedly, his uncle asked.

[“Somewhere you want to go……. Where are you planning to go?”]

“That’s what I wanted to ask you.”

Jeong Taeui spoke hesitantly. His uncle didn’t say anything, just waited for Jeong Taeui’s next question. Jeong Taeui hesitated a bit more before speaking.

“Do you know where Ilay is?”

The other end of the line didn’t respond immediately. It was quite a while before Jeong Taeui mumbled: “Hello?” again, but there was still no answer.

[“…….”]

“Hello, uncle, is your phone disconnected?”

After Jeong Taeui asked again, he finally received a response: [“No, it’s not disconnected.”]

However, after that, his uncle remained silent for a long time before speaking heavily.

[“Are you planning to go to him?”]

“Yes.”

Jeong Taeui answered without hesitation. Then he smiled.

“It’ll be okay……. although I’m a little worried.”

[“A little worried…….”]

His uncle mumbled vaguely as if talking to himself. Not too worried, just a little worried?

Jeong Taeui suddenly recalled what his uncle had told him the previous night.

“Jeong Taeui. You have to be careful with your life. Do you realize you’ve turned Rick into a chicken-chasing dog?”

The expression on Jeong Taeui’s face went blank.

For whatever reason, he had turned his back on Ilay.

Even if he could go back to that moment, Jeong Taeui would still make the same choice. In that situation, his priority couldn’t be Ilay. But now, belatedly, Jeong Taeui remembered that man.

What had Ilay thought when Jeong Taeui turned his back on him after he had accepted leaving everything behind to urgently search for him?

“…….If only he had kept his inhuman nature a bit longer.”

Jeong Taeui murmured sadly. If only.

If only that had been the case, he wouldn’t have had to see that face, full of happiness, suddenly turn to extreme worry. And if that had been the case, he wouldn’t have been haunted by this for so long.

Jeong Taeui remembered Ilay’s face back then, repeatedly tapping his chest to calm his thumping heart.

He carefully asked his uncle.

“Was he very angry?”

[“Well, I didn’t see it firsthand, so it’s hard to say, but if I were you, I’d rather run away from Rieg forever than go back. It’s better than dying as soon as you meet him again.”]

Jeong Taeui frowned.

“Uncle, you’re scaring me……. Alright, I’m already scared, so I’m trying not to think about it.”

His heart was pounding. Surely, if he went back, things wouldn’t end well for him. Still, he probably wouldn’t be killed immediately. But if not sooner, then definitely later.

Jeong Taeui steeled himself. If Ilay threw punches, he would have no choice but to take them all, so he would have to quickly explain everything to him before getting beaten to death.

Thinking about being beaten and cursed at while trying to explain made the prospect seem bleak, but with the strong belief that he wouldn’t die, he managed to somewhat soothe his thumping heart.

“So, where is he?”

When Jeong Taeui asked, his uncle mumbled: [“So, you’ve decided to go after all?”]

Jeong Taeui laughed, feeling the concern from his uncle.

“Anyway, I have to go back. I told him I would return.”

Although he couldn’t hear it at the time. Jeong Taeui sighed.

[“Now, I’m not sure. I heard he caused a ruckus in Saudi Arabia and then went to Seringe, but after that, I was busy dealing with that mess.”]

“Handling it……. wasn’t it just about dismissing Ilay?”

[“Just that alone required writing seven reports.”]

Since the terrorist attacks began, his uncle probably had to stay up at night, which is why he sounded so tired from lack of sleep. Aigoo, it’s probably best not to press him further. Jeong Taeui stopped pestering his uncle and asked again.

[“Anyway, I’ll have more information soon, so call me when you get to the airport.”]

“I’ll have to make a lot of calls when I get there, huh? The passport broker, the corrupt police officer, and you…….”

[“The police will hold the passport, so you only need to make one call when you get there.”]

“…….Isn’t it a serious problem if even the police are involved in using fake passports?”

[“That’s why they’re called corrupt cops.”]

His uncle laughed. Jeong Taeui remained silent for a moment before smiling. Shortly after, his uncle reminded him to call when he arrived at the airport, then hung up.

Jeong Taeui left the convenience store and paused to lament the world’s dark corners for a moment.

While some police are trying their best to catch a wanted criminal, others are doing everything to prevent that and are even involved in handling fake passports under the direction of a member of an international organization. Well, corruption exists everywhere. Jeong Taeui stopped lamenting and left the hotel.

The bus stop for the airport was right across from the hotel. When he asked, the receptionist said there were about three buses an hour, but at such an early hour, there was only one. Hopefully, he wouldn’t be unlucky enough to just miss the bus and have to wait a whole hour for the next one. Jeong Taeui reached the bus stop, checked the expected arrival time, and sat on the bench. The next bus was in 30 minutes.

That was lucky enough, better than arriving just a minute after the previous bus had left and having to wait for an hour. 

Jeong Taeui looked around. There was a public transport card service kiosk and a vending machine next to each other right by the bus stop. He stared at the can of beer in the vending machine.

Immediately, Xinlu’s card was charged the exact amount for the can of beer.

It was early morning, so there were very few people around. The sky was gradually transitioning from the dark of night to the light blue of dawn, but the street remained silent.

Drinking beer while waiting for the bus in this peaceful and blue dawn was quite an interesting experience.

“If I set off now, when will I get there…….? I need to know where he is to set the destination for the flight and at least calculate the travel time.”

Jeong Taeui thought as he sipped his beer.

But.

He had come back.

Jeong Taeui was sitting here now to return to Ilay.

No wonder he felt so strange. A mixture of odd and gloomy feelings. Ever since his schizophrenia acted up, he had felt uneasy. His uncle had also said it might be wiser to try and run away forever. That was exactly what Xinlu had advised him as well.

Yet, after all, despite such advice, his heart still yearned for that man.

“I have to give back what he lost……. He also lost his humanity, so I wish I could reduce that inhumanity a bit.”

Jeong Taeui sighed.

Then suddenly, reality hit him.

If he went to the airport now and managed to reach whatever country Ilay was hiding in – wherever he was hiding – it would still be very difficult to find him since a terrorist like him wouldn’t appear out in the open.

He tried to imagine the scene of their reunion. And it wasn’t hard to picture it.

Surely that moment would give him chills. There was no way he wouldn’t feel terrified in front of that monster. Moreover, his circumstances then would be much more horrifying.

“It’s best to explain as soon as possible when getting hit, even if it means getting hit one less time.”

Even though he was always sure that his life would be threatened upon his return, he never thought he wouldn’t go back to Ilay.

Because that unfamiliar voice and expression of his lingered in his heart.

“…….I will come back soon.”

Jeong Taeui repeated the words he had said to Ilay but which Ilay had never heard. Suddenly, his heart tightened. Jeong Taeui smiled calmly.

A car was moving slowly right in front of the bus stop.

Jeong Taeui looked at his watch, there were still 10 minutes until the bus would arrive.

The car slowed down and stopped a few steps away from the bus stop. He happened to glance up, it was a taxi.

Jeong Taeui waved at the driver, thinking the taxi wanted to pick up a passenger, but that wasn’t the case. The rear door suddenly opened, and a man stepped out. It seemed the taxi had stopped to drop off a passenger, not to pick one up.

It was early, and the man stepping out right in front of the hotel made it seem like he had just come from the airport.

Jeong Taeui casually looked up.

And at that moment.

The beer can in his hand suddenly felt scorching hot, dropping with a thud onto the pavement.

The man who had just stepped out of the car slowly closed the taxi door, his straight back facing him. He tilted his head slightly, slowly putting on the clean gloves from his pocket and giving Jeong Taeui a vague smile. That cold smile looked so unfamiliar.

“Your intuition seems sharp, Taeil. You knew I would come, so you tried to run away, didn’t you?”

The man spoke.

One step…

Two steps…

A calm voice sounded…

Jeong Taeui looked at him with a half-stunned, half-ghostly expression. The man glanced at Jeong Taeui and then at the electronic board showing the bus schedule. Then he smirked.

“If I had been 10 minutes late, I might have missed you again.”

He smiled happily and looked back at Jeong Taeui. The tall man was looking down at him from above and then glanced around him as if it was peculiar.

“Why are you alone? Where’s that kid?”

Jeong Taeui, still dazed, could only shake his head vigorously as he looked at him. The man raised an eyebrow and clicked his tongue but then nodded.

“Alright. Anyway, that kid will die soon. What matters now isn’t him.”

He smiled and gently leaned down, almost touching his forehead to Jeong Taeui’s.

The man whispered into his ear. His lips parted several times to utter each sentence joyfully.

“Got you. Taei.”
